Maritime Alert: IMO Adopts Ship Routing Measures Designating Areas to be Avoided in Alaska’s Aleutian Island Region By Vessels Using The Great Circle Route On International Voyages
On 16 June 2015, the Maritime Safety Commission of the IMO adopted new vessel routing measures aimed at reducing the risk of marine casualties and related pollution from large vessels operating in the vicinity of Alaska’s Aleutian Island archipelago. The measures...

Maritime Alert: IMO Adopts Additional Provisions to Polar Code, Imposing Mandatory Environmental and Safety Requirements on Vessels Traversing Polar Waters
On 15 May, 2015 the IMO adopted the environmental provisions of the International Code for Ships Operating in Polar Waters (the “Polar Code”), which will now require vessels in polar waters to comply with various safety and environmental requirements imposed by the...

Employment Alert: California Becomes Second State To Mandate Paid Sick Leave
On Wednesday, September 10, 2014, California’s Governor Jerry Brown signed the Healthy Workplaces, Healthy Families Act of 2014, requiring California employers to provide paid sick leave to employees who work 30 or more days per year. The Act becomes effective July...
